Transaction ec748679347b0325a76bb88a99766ee2c0455e70b40eb87e6ca4d19c1ea2b568
1 Input
1 Output
-
ec748679347b0325a76bb88a99766ee2c0455e70b40eb87e6ca4d19c1ea2b568:0
- value
- 312272
- script pubkey
- OP_0 OP_PUSHBYTES_32 fba7489d054036bc9fe0836d4815ffbbdb369d09e89796ac46544aa49e706bbc
- address
- bc1qlwn538g9gqmte8lqsdk5s90lh0dnd8gfaztedtzx2392f8nsdw7q8cwkmh